Navan is a name often given to boys. Ranked #11822 and holds a steady place on the charts. It comes from a Sanskrit (Indian) origin and traditionally means "New leader or sacred navigator". It has 2 syllables.
Navan originates in Sanskrit, implying renewal and guidance. It fits families exploring Vedic-inspired names. The name suggests forward movement and spiritual insight. Boys called Navan tend to be curious explorers with natural charisma. Its brevity makes it versatile across cultures.
